Easy hiking trails around National Park Fuentes del Narcea Degaña e Ibias traverse a landscape characterized by ancient forests, mountainous terrain, and river valleys. This region, a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ve, features extensive woodlands, including significant oak and beech forests, alongside rivers like the Narcea and Ibias that have sculpted the terrain. The park's elevation ranges from riverbeds to peaks over 2,000 meters, offering varied topography for outdoor exploration.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many easy hiking trails are available in National Park Fuentes del Narcea, Degaña e Ibias?

There are 4 easy hiking trails specifically highlighted in this guide, offering accessible options to explore the park's natural beauty. Overall, the park features over 500 kilometers of marked trails, with 28 routes tracked on komoot, catering to various experience levels.

What kind of landscapes can I expect on easy hikes in this National Park?

Easy hikes in National Park Fuentes del Narcea, Degaña e Ibias will take you through diverse landscapes. You can expect to encounter ancient oak and beech forests, river valleys carved by the Narcea and Ibias rivers, and areas showcasing glacial features, particularly around higher elevations. The region is known for its rich woodlands and mountainous terrain.

Are there any circular routes suitable for easy hiking?

Yes, several easy routes are circular. For instance, the Laguna de Arbás loop from Brañas / Leitariegos is a 3.5 km circular trail offering views of the glacial landscape. Another option is the Oballo Chapel loop from Oubachu, a 3.2 km path with scenic views.

What are some notable landmarks or points of interest I might see on an easy hike?

Along easy hiking trails, you might encounter various points of interest. The Oballo Chapel loop from Oubachu offers views of the historic Oballo Chapel. The region also features several mountain passes like Pozo de las Mujeres Muertas Pass and Puerto de Leitariegos, which provide scenic vistas. The park's ancient forests, such as the Muniellos Integral Nature Reserve, are also significant natural landmarks.

What do other hikers say about the easy trails in National Park Fuentes del Narcea, Degaña e Ibias?

The easy trails in National Park Fuentes del Narcea, Degaña e Ibias are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.6 stars from over 60 reviews. Hikers often praise the tranquil atmosphere, the beauty of the ancient forests, and the well-maintained paths that make for an enjoyable experience.

Is National Park Fuentes del Narcea, Degaña e Ibias suitable for family-friendly hikes?

Yes, the park offers several routes that are ideal for families. The easy trails, with their manageable distances and gentle elevation changes, provide a great opportunity for families to explore nature together. Routes like the Laguna de Arbás loop are relatively short and offer engaging scenery.

What is the best time of year to go easy hiking in this region?

The National Park Fuentes del Narcea, Degaña e Ibias is beautiful year-round, but for easy hiking, spring and autumn are particularly recommended. In spring, the forests burst with new growth, and in autumn, the extensive oak and beech woodlands display vibrant colors. Summer also offers pleasant conditions, especially in the mornings or late afternoons, while winter can bring snow to higher elevations, making some trails more challenging.

Are there any easy trails that follow river valleys?

Yes, the park's terrain is sculpted by rivers like the Narcea and Ibias. The Cangas del Narcea to Courias trail, for example, leads through the Narcea river valley, offering a gentle path alongside the water and through the surrounding natural environment.

What is the typical duration and distance for an easy hike here?

Easy hikes in National Park Fuentes del Narcea, Degaña e Ibias typically range from 3 to 6.5 kilometers (2 to 4 miles) in distance. You can expect to complete these trails in about 1 to 2 hours, depending on your pace and how often you stop to enjoy the scenery. For example, the Laguna de Arbás loop is 3.5 km and takes about 1 hour 8 minutes.

Are there opportunities for wildlife spotting on easy hikes?

As a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ve, the park is rich in biodiversity, offering opportunities for wildlife observation even on easy trails. While sightings are never guaranteed, the park is home to species like roe deer, wild boar, and various birds. It's also a crucial area for endangered species such as the Cantabrian brown bear and Cantabrian capercaillie, though these are more elusive.

What is the elevation gain like on easy trails in the park?

Easy trails in National Park Fuentes del Narcea, Degaña e Ibias are characterized by gentle elevation changes, making them accessible for most hikers. For example, the Corias – Cemetery loop from Courias has an elevation gain of approximately 89 meters, while the Laguna de Arbás loop has about 156 meters of ascent, spread over its distance.
